sorry to here that. Go to your Bios and see if you see any frequency control if not then you will have to change the M/B or see if there is any bios update for your M/B. I think your gateway M/B is based off the msi ms-7399 not sure. If so you may be able to flash your bios with the msi ms-7399 Bios and unlock the Oc settings if the msi ms-7399 even has any im not sure. But this also could cause your M/B not to work or boot up at all and then you would have to buy a new bios chip but if you gatway is anything like my old gateway they soder the Bios chip to the M/B to make it hard to do that.

By upgrading to windows 7 you do you mean a clean install or just upgrade? ether way if your changing you M/B you should always reload windows so that windows can load drivers for your M/B. If you don't it may not work right like BSOD ect. From what I can tell the MSI x48c looks like a good overclocker
http://forum-en.msi.com/index.php?PH...topic=116142.0

But every hardware Oc different some Oc very high and some do not.

Bye the way you do know that LGA 775 is phasing out ? LGA 1366 and 1156 is replacing them but if you wanted a 1366 or a 1156 you would need a new cpu and ram.

yes it will but do it after you get your new M/B not before. If you do it be for you will have to reinstall again. Some times you can get buy but your old M/B drivers could cause conflicts with your new M/B drivers.
